On November 13, Pfizer's Class 1 new drug PF-06940434 injection received tacit approval for clinical trials in China, according to the official website of the Center for Drug Evaluation (CDE) of the National Medical Products Administration (NMPA).Proposed Development for the Treatment of Patients with Advanced or Metastatic Solid Tumors. Public information shows that this is Pfizer'sIntegrin αvβ8 Antagonist, is currently conducting Phase 1 clinical trials overseas.

Public data shows that integrin αvβ8 is a cell surface protein, and recent studies have found that it plays a significant promoting role in the occurrence and development of tumors. First,Integrinαvβ8Contributes to the migration and invasion of tumor cellsIt can directly interact with proteins in the extracellular matrix, enhancing the cell's ability to adhere to and invade the matrix, thereby promoting tumor spread. Secondly,Integrinαvβ8Can promote the occurrence and development of tumors by activating the transforming growth factor-β (TGF-β) signaling pathway.TGF-β is a key regulatory factor for cell proliferation and differentiation, and the overactivated TGF-β signaling pathway plays a significant promoting role in many types of tumors. Additionally, integrinsαvβ8May also participate in the occurrence and development of tumors through various mechanisms such as affecting the tumor microenvironment, promoting intercellular signal communication, and maintaining cancer stem cells.
